About Whisky Tasting and Tales

Join us for an unforgettable whisky tasting evening in our cosy lounge, where you'll savour each sip and delve into whisky's rich role in Scotland’s heritage.

Seated in our cosy whisky lounge you will you'll taste four distinct whiskies while exploring the rich history and cultural significance of whisky in Scotland. Our expert guides will share engaging stories, adding depth and entertainment to your whisky tasting experience.

The Whiskies:
Savour a whisky from each of Scotland’s regions: the Lowlands, Highlands, Speyside, and Islay. Each region has its own unique flavours and character, as a result, we find that each of our guests comes out of the whisky tasting with a favourite region.

This isn’t just a tasting; it’s a hands-on dive into Scotland’s heritage that really brings whisky and Scottish culture to life.
